python爬虫是干嘛的

Python爬虫主要用于自动收集万维网上的信息或数据。以下是关于Python爬虫的详细解释:一、定义与功能 定义:Python爬虫是一种按照一定的规则,自动地抓取万维网信息的程序或者脚本。功能:通过程序模拟浏览器请求站点的行为,自动获取web页面上用户想要的数据,并提取、存储这些数据以供后续使用。二、技术原理 ...
python爬虫是干嘛的
Python爬虫主要用于自动收集万维网上的信息或数据。以下是关于Python爬虫的详细解释:
一、定义与功能
定义:Python爬虫是一种按照一定的规则,自动地抓取万维网信息的程序或者脚本。功能:通过程序模拟浏览器请求站点的行为,自动获取web页面上用户想要的数据,并提取、存储这些数据以供后续使用。二、技术原理
模拟浏览器请求:爬虫程序会模拟用户通过浏览器访问网站的行为,向目标网站发送HTTP请求。解析HTML/JSON:收到网站的响应后,爬虫会解析返回的HTML或JSON数据,从中提取用户需要的信息。数据存储:提取到的数据可以存储在本地文件、数据库或云存储中,以便后续的分析和处理。三、应用场景
数据采集:用于收集网站上的公开数据,如新闻、商品信息、股票价格等。搜索引擎:搜索引擎的爬虫会遍历互联网,收集网页信息,构建索引,以便用户搜索。数据分析:结合数据分析工具,对爬虫收集到的数据进行处理和分析,挖掘有价值的信息。自动化测试:可以用于网站的自动化测试,检查网站的链接是否有效、内容是否更新等。四、注意事项
合规性:在使用爬虫收集数据时,需要遵守目标网站的robots.txt协议和相关法律法规,避免侵犯他人的知识产权和隐私。性能优化:为了提高爬虫的效率,可以采用多线程、异步请求等技术,同时需要注意对目标网站的压力控制,避免造成不必要的负担。2025-04-01
mengvlog 阅读 8 次 更新于 2025-07-20 07:38:45 我来答关注问题0
  •  宜美生活妙招 python爬虫有什么用

    Python爬虫的主要作用包括以下几个方面:网络数据采集:信息抓取:Python爬虫能够按照预设的规则,自动从网站上抓取数据。这些数据可以是文本、图片、视频等任何形式的信息。大规模数据收集:通过并发请求和多线程等技术,Python爬虫可以高效地收集大量数据,为后续的数据分析提供基础。大数据分析:数据源获取:在...

  •  翡希信息咨询 python爬虫是什么意思

    Python爬虫是一种按照一定的规则,自动地抓取万维网信息的程序。它通过模拟客户端发送网络请求,并接收网络响应,从而获取网页上的数据。工作原理:发送请求:爬虫程序会模拟浏览器向目标网站发送HTTP请求。接收响应:网站服务器接收到请求后,会返回相应的HTML文档或其他类型的数据。数据提取:爬虫程序会解析返...

  •  宜美生活妙招 python爬虫是什么意思

    Python爬虫是指使用Python编程语言编写的网络爬虫程序。一、定义 Python爬虫是一种按照一定的规则,自动地抓取万维网信息的程序。它通过模拟客户端(如浏览器)发送网络请求,获取网络响应,并按照预设的规则提取和保存所需的数据。二、工作原理 发送请求:爬虫程序首先向目标网站发送HTTP请求,模拟用户在浏览器...

  •  宜美生活妙招 python爬虫是什么

    Python爬虫是一种使用Python编程语言编写的网络爬虫程序。以下是对Python爬虫的详细解释:一、定义与功能 定义:Python爬虫,即利用Python语言开发的一种自动化程序,用于从互联网上抓取、分析和收集数据。功能:它模拟人类浏览器的行为,访问网站、读取网页内容、提取所需信息,并将这些信息保存到本地数据库或...

  • Python爬虫是一种按照一定规则自动抓取万维网信息的程序,主要用于收集数据。以下是对Python爬虫的具体解释:一、Python爬虫的定义 Python爬虫是一种利用Python编程语言编写的网络爬虫程序。它能够模拟人类的行为,在网页上自动执行点击、浏览、抓取等操作,从而收集所需的信息。二、Python爬虫的功能 数据收集:...

檬味博客在线解答立即免费咨询

Python相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部